GE Money already employs over 300 workers in Ostrava customer service centre

GE Money's customer service centre, opened in April this year, represents an important investment for the Moravia-Silesia region. The company has invested over USD 4 million and plans to expand here in the future, thus becoming a significant employer in this region suffering from high unemployment.

GE Money already employs over 300 workers in Ostrava customer service centre

"This investment illustrates how other large cities in the Czech Republic, such as Ostrava, have great potential as locations for business-support services centres," says Tomas Hruda, CEO of CzechInvest. Evzen Tosenovsky, Governor of the Moravia-Silesia region, adds: "This is an indicator that for many companies our region is interesting and more advantageous than Prague for implementing essential operations."

In competition with other, mainly university cities, Ostrava was selected thanks to the capacity of its labour market and qualified workforce, which is a key factor in staffing business-support services centres. Other important factors were the city's good transport accessibility, suitable infrastructure and preparedness of the land for the investment construction.

According to A.T. Kearney, the Czech Republic ranked seventh in the world in 2005 as an ideal location for provision of global services, whereas a study by the Economist Intelligence Unit ranks the country in third place immediately behind India and China.

"GE Money is planning to expand in Ostrava. The customer service centre is functioning very well. In connection with this, as GE Money experiences dynamic growth in the Czech Republic and Slovakia, we will also expand the customer service centre in Ostrava," says Pieter van Groos, Country Manager GE Money for the Czech Republic and Slovakia and CEO of GE Money Bank. "Today 308 employees work here; by the end of 2008 there should be 500," adds Magdalena Wavle, director of GE Money's customer service centre in Ostrava-Hrabova.

The customer service centre serves GE Money's clients in the Czech Republic and Slovakia. In addition to serving customers, the centre's employees are also responsible for ancillary processes, training, claims administration and data verification.

More about GE Money

Headquartered in Stamford, Connecticut in the United States, GE Money is a GE subsidiary with assets of almost USD 106 billion and is a leading provider of credit services to consumers, retailers and car dealers in over 41 countries worldwide. The company provides credit cards, personal loans, sales financing, automotive loans and leases, mortgage loans and credit insurance. GE Money operates three divisions in the Czech Republic: GE Money Bank, GE Money Multiservis and GE Money Auto.
